What defines a flex property and how does it differ from other commercial spaces in Seattle?

A flex property in Seattle is a type of commercial space that offers a flexible layout, allowing tenants to customize the space to suit their specific needs. Unlike traditional office spaces, flex properties often feature open floor plans, movable walls, and adaptable infrastructure, making them ideal for businesses that require a high degree of flexibility and adaptability, such as startups, tech companies, and creative agencies.
